you should double check your manual because I had a 2003 ram 2500 with the hemi and it did recommend 91 or above for fuel. I did some research back then and found that very few engines these days do need high octane fuel. The hemi falls into that category because it has high compression. I always ran mine on on 91 or above and never had any engine issues.........rust, however was a different story.
